Deputy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Ishaq Dar has said the government is fully focusing on reforms agenda for economic stability in the country.Addressing a ceremony in Islamabad today, he said country's economy has immense potential to grow but there is a need to remove hurdles.Ishaq Dar said Pakistan can become an emerging international market by enhancing exports.He said the establishment of the Special Investment Facilitation Council and One-Window Facility will be useful to attract the Foreign Direct Investment.Source: Radio Pakistan
